The Flash #130 (DC, 1962) CGC NM 9.4 White pages. Once again, a stunning copy from David N. Toth! This is one of the most impressive because until now, the highest grade CGC has awarded for #130 is VF/NM 9.0. The largely black cover is unforgiving, showing the slightest defect, but this copy simply has none, and even boasts white pages. Inside, villains abound with the first appearance of the Gauntlet of Super-Villains. There are also Elongated Man and Kid Flash backup stories, with art by Carmine Infantino, who also did the cover with help from his frequent collaborator Murphy Anderson cover. Overstreet 2008 NM- 9.2 value = $325. CGC census 4/08: 1 in 9.4, none higher. From the David N. Toth Collection.
